Teen faces charges after deputies find brass knuckle belt clip, switchblade
By WKTV News
WATSON, N.Y. (WKTV)
- The Lewis County Sheriff's Office has charged a teen with criminal possession of a weapon after an incident on Pine Grove Road.
The Sheriff's office says deputies were called to 6813 Pine Grove Road for a disturbance complaint.
When they arrived, they say Kyle Simpson, 18, got irate toward the deputies and the others at the home.
When they searched him, they say they found a switchblade knife and a brass knuckle belt clip.
He faces two counts of criminal possession of a weapon.
